Transaction 62b01254afdaea4b37515536b6dce522d66b10f5cfb59c3d34501bcb7bbfe735
1 Input
1 Output
-
62b01254afdaea4b37515536b6dce522d66b10f5cfb59c3d34501bcb7bbfe735:0
- value
- 24997160
- script pubkey
- OP_0 OP_PUSHBYTES_20 beea9c65bfb42b77e8aaabb90f72c2ed1406f155
- address
- bc1qhm4fcedlks4h06924wus7ukza52qdu24cvz087